2016 - 2024

感恩一路有你

爬虫python入门 Python是什么,什么是爬虫?具体该怎么学习?

浏览量:1985 时间:2021-03-16 02:31:57 作者:admin

Python是什么,什么是爬虫?具体该怎么学习?

Python是为数不多的既简单又功能强大的编程语言之一。它易于学习和理解,易于上手,代码更接近自然语言和正常的思维方式。据统计,Python是世界上最流行的语言之一。

爬虫是利用爬虫技术捕获论坛、网站数据,将所需数据保存到数据库或特定格式的文件中。

具体学习:

1)首先,学习python的基本知识,了解网络请求的原理和网页的结构。

2)视频学习或找专业的网络爬虫书学习。所谓“前辈种树,后人乘凉”,按照大神的步骤进行实际操作,就能事半功倍。

3)网站的实际操作,在有了爬虫的想法后,找到更多的网站进行操作。

转行python爬虫,能找到工作吗?

首先,在目前的大数据应用环境下,如果只是做Python爬虫开发,那么仍然缺乏工作竞争力。为了找到一份满意的工作,我们需要进一步改善我们的知识结构。

Python语言广泛应用于整个IT行业,包括web开发(传统解决方案之一)、大数据开发、人工智能开发(机器学习等)、嵌入式开发和各种后端服务开发。然而,得益于大数据和人工智能的发展,python语言近年来有了明显的上升趋势,未来的发展空间仍然非常广阔,值得期待。

随着Python语言的发展,许多程序员开始转向Python开发。在学习Python开发的过程中,一个常见的例子是使用Python开发crawler。用Python开发crawler更加方便,特别是在当前大数据时代,通过crawler获取web数据是一种常见的数据采集方式,因此在大数据应用的早期阶段,通过Python开发crawler是众多Python程序员的重要工作内容之一。

但是,随着大数据采集技术的逐渐成熟,一些爬虫工具越来越完善,通过Python开发爬虫的需求也在一定程度上下降,这在一定程度上降低了Python爬虫开发的工作需求。早期,Python crawler从事的工作大多集中在互联网公司和行业信息公司。随着相关岗位人员配置的逐步完善,这些岗位的招聘需求必然下降。

随着物联网的发展,大数据的采集将向物联网和产业转移,这也是产业互联网发展阶段的一个重要特征。因此,仅从事Python爬虫开发的未来就业形势并不明朗。建议通过python进一步掌握数据分析的技巧。

Python自动化测试和爬虫哪个方向比较好呢?很纠结以后是做自动化测试还是爬虫?

我对这两个帖子很熟悉,所以我敢说几句。

1. 自动测试和爬虫是两个不同的方向。尽管看起来很多技术栈是相同的(selenium和appnium、数据包捕获工具等),crawler的核心是反爬网,而测试的核心是业务。

2. 爬虫岗位核心竞争力:爬虫是反爬虫,即反爬虫能力。许多目标网站可以通过定义字体库和识别浏览器指纹来实现反爬网。仅仅通过selenium等渲染工具无法满足一个合格的爬虫工程师的技术要求。让我说爬行动物最需要的是对抗能力。如果他们没有很强的自学能力和抗压能力,最好做这类业务的测试工作,否则几年后就可能下岗。

3. 测试岗:大部分测试都是纯业务,不同于爬虫的对抗岗。工作中几乎没有未知的场景,因此相对而言,更大的压力在于业务场景。我只想评判这部分。

如果市场需求曲线不是很平滑,对职位晋升能力的考验就要平滑得多。爬虫是一种比较复杂的工作,一开始可能很难找到工作。不过,高中毕业后的工资还是不错的,后期的技术发展前景也比较好,但估计能坚持下来的人很少(坚持下来的基本上都是丹尼尔)。事实上,很多人会做整个堆栈或后端。毕竟爬虫确实是一项艰苦的工作,而且它有很好的爬虫能力(基本的前后都比较熟悉)。

最后:事实上,这取决于个人职业规划。如果你对自己的能力更有信心,你可以成为一个爬虫。如果你想要稳定性,你应该做自动化测试。毕竟,爬虫太难了。

爬虫python入门 爬虫技术python python爬虫接单网

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。